The Backgrounds

By YanHeng

Information society provides our more convenient access to various resources, especially for artists re-creation. The all rights reserved traditional copyright places a gulf among artists and originators. what CC advocates share, remix and reuse legally hopes to have better interactivity between creation and communication. While relieve the confrontation better free communication and legally access.

29th March, 2006, under the joint efforts of Project Lead, Pro. Wang and other CC advocators, 2.5 version of CC China mainland license was put into public. against this background, CC China Mainland has started its all around promotional activities in 3 main sectors, from arts, OER to science data. This can be regard as the embryo of our arts promotional program.

The 1st CC Photography Contest China 2007

Our 1st activity of the arts program CC Photography Contest China 2007VenueNational Library
It was joint-organized by CC China mainland & Nphoto net. More than 3,000 Netizens presented about 10,000 high-quality photos. Some famous photographers from U.S, Canada, Australia, Malaysia, HK, Macau and Taiwan province. In the meantime, the contest has been recognized as a high-tone social event for large amount of CC supports.

The 1st Large-Scale CC Contemporary Art


Exhibition Remix and Share

The 1st Large-Scale CC Contemporary Art Exhibition Remix and Share Time: Dec, 2009 Venue: 798 Art Zone, Beijing

Co-organized by CC China Mainland and Artintern, and with additional support from a number of organizations including Inter Art Center, Hudong wiki, and mash4. More than 200 participants, including artists presenting their works, the media, invited guests from various fields, and the project team and volunteers of CC China Mainland, came to attend the opening ceremony. The exhibition presents CC-licensed art works from artists across the country. It received so much responses that during just a one month period, more than 200 artists have submitted works in various forms including new media, devices, videos, easel painting, etc. Works presented at the exhibit are from more than 60 artists, selected to match the size of the venue and theme of the event. Some well-known Chinese artists including Cao Fei, Yan Jun, Wu Xiaojun and Liu Wei are also invited to present their CC licensed works at the exhibit.

Remix and Share Cross-Domain Forum Time: Dec, 2009 Venue: Open at 798 Art Zone After the opening ceremony, Artists and members from CC China Mainland, joined by project leads and representatives from Creative Commons Asia-Pacific Region including Taiwan, Hong Kong and Australia, convened a forum under the theme of the exhibition: Remix and Share.

2010 Screenage Art Document Exhibition

2010 Screenage Art Document Exhibition Time:18th, April 2010 Venue: Songzhuang Art Center
Hosted by Songzhuang Art Center, which is famous landmark for concerning Chinas modern arts status qua. The exhibition was composed of multiple sections including the Field, the Domain, the Emotion, Natural Unnatural, and Gathering Recalling. A number of CC-licensed photographic and video works were shown. CC China Mainland, as one of the supporting organization of this event, also had its representatives to present in the opening ceremony.

The 2nd Focus on China Exhibition of CC licensed Photographs of China

The 2nd Focus on China Exhibition of CC licensed Photographs of China Time: 31st, March 2012 Venue: 798 Art Zone, Beijing Curator: Zhu Handong, project manager of CC China Mainland

Social media & websites were used for collecting works from the public. Nearly 4,000 photo were contributed by more than 300 photographers in less than 1 month. The shortlist was consisted of 30 of them. All works focused on Chinas urbanization, leftover-children, stay-at-home elders, environment pollution etc. It truly reached our object of focus on China through your eyes.

The 2nd Focus on China Itinerant Exhibition in 12th China Pingyao

The 2nd Focus on China Itinerant Exhibition in 12th China Pingyao International Photograph Festival Time: 19th-25th, Sep 2012 Venue: Pingao, Shanxi 1st time for CC licensing photos group show in an influential international photograph festival. 3 photographers works were rewarded.

More than 1700 photographers from 45 countries took part in this festival. Cross Asia, North America, Africa and Australia. Nearly 13,000 photos were shown there. Lots of people raised their interests for CC licensed works.

Maker Carnival 2012

Maker Carnival 2012 Time: 28th, April 2012 Venue: China Millennium Monument It was co-organized by Beijing maker space, CMM, the Interaction design Lab of China Central Academy of Fine Arts and sponsored by CC China Mainland. Maker is backbone of open-source community, especially OS hardware. As an effective sharing and creation system, OS give each of us the right to learn, improve, distribute and spread. OS hardware overturns the traditional close-creation concept and largely enhance the overall vitality of the people. OS hardwares diversification and individuality are strengthened through the open of design, working drawing and technology.

Theme forum of Maker Carnival 2012: Creative Commons with Knowledge Sharing and Product Innovation Time: 29th, April 2012 Venue: China Millennium Monument

As one of the important session of Maker Carnival 2012. Participated by copyright experts, artists and various makers from home and abroad. They discussed what are the problems in OS and innovation when confronting with copyright.

Current problems need to be addressed


Our arts promotional program has positive influences for artists creation regarding the sharing concept we advocated for years. Many artists are very happy to engaged in. But attentions paid for CC-licensed works dont sound higher than those non CC-licensed works, why does this happen? Some work-sharing websites place more restriction on. Under this condition, sharing tends to be more exclusive. We dont have a purely sharing & communication website for art works. Its not easy to get funding for NGOs like us, who devotes on the promotion of cultural & arts sharing activities. This dose affect our future program.
